1989 Regular season
Player of the Year
Arizona vs Duke
77 - 75
26 February, 1989
Sean Elliott, a Tuscon native and Arizona's all-time leading scorer, shined in the spotlight during a nationally televised game against Duke. With only 53 seconds left, Elliott's clutch 3-pointer not only won the game, it propeled Arizona to a #1 overall ranking as well as help push him to winning the Wooden award.
